Opportunity Summary 

This internship offers practical exposure to executive leadership and operational management within a community-based medical clinic serving diverse and often underserved populations. The experience emphasizes mission-driven healthcare delivery, regulatory compliance, and sustainable clinic operations. The intern will work closely with clinic leadership to understand how administrative strategies support high-quality, patient-centered care in a resource-conscious environment.

Opportunity Learning Outcomes 

By the end of the internship, participants will gain: • Practical understanding of healthcare administration in a medical clinic setting • Exposure to executive-level decision-making • Experience balancing financial sustainability with mission-driven service • Foundational leadership competencies applicable to future roles in healthcare management

Opportunity Training 

Core Learning Areas 1. Clinic Operations Management 2. Financial & Revenue Cycle Oversight 3. Regulatory Compliance & Risk Management 4. Quality Improvement & Performance Metrics 5. Human Resources & Team Leadership 6. Strategic Planning & Community Impact
